Rivendellaudio/docs/tables/rd_airplay.txt
Fred Gleason 9a65658267 2021-04-27 Fred Gleason <fredg@paravelsystems.com>
* Changed the 'RDAIRPLAY_EXIT_PASSWORD' field from 'varchar(41)'
	to 'varchar(48)'.
	* Incremented the database version to 349.
	* Renamed the 'RDSha1Hash()' function to 'RDSha1HashFile()'.
	* Added 'RDSha1HashPassword()' function in 'lib/rdhash.[cpp|h]'.
	* Added 'RDSha1HashCheckPassword()' function in 'lib/rdhash.[cpp|h]'.
	* Changed the hashing algorithm used for the Exit Password for
	rdairplay(1) to salted SHA1.

Signed-off-by: Fred Gleason <fredg@paravelsystems.com>
2021-04-27 16:52:26 -04:00

37 lines
1.5 KiB
Plaintext

RDAIRPLAY Table Layout for Rivendell
The RDAIRPLAY table holds configuration data for the RDAirPlay widget.
FIELD NAME TYPE REMARKS
------------------------------------------------------------------------------
ID int(10) unsigned * Primary key, Auto Increment
SEGUE_LENGTH int(11)
TRANS_LENGTH int(11)
LOG_MODE_STYLE int(11) 0=Unified, 1=Independent
PIE_COUNT_LENGTH int(11)
PIE_COUNT_ENDPOINT int(11) 0=EOF, 1=Segue Point
CHECK_TIMESYNC enum('N','Y')
STATION_PANELS int(11)
USER_PANELS int(11)
SHOW_AUX_1 enum('N','Y')
SHOW_AUX_2 enum('N','Y')
CLEAR_FILTER enum('N','Y')
DEFAULT_TRANS_TYPE int(11)
BAR_ACTION int(10) unsigned 0=None, 1=Start Next
FLASH_PANEL enum('N','Y')
PANEL_PAUSE_ENABLED enum('N','Y')
BUTTON_LABEL_TEMPLATE varchar(32)
PAUSE_ENABLED enum('N','Y')
DEFAULT_SERVICE varchar(10) From SERVICES.NAME
HOUR_SELECTOR_ENABLED enum('N','Y')
EXIT_CODE int(11) 0=clean, 1=dirty
VIRTUAL_EXIT_CODE int(11) 0=clean, 1=dirty
EXIT_PASSWORD varchar(48)
SKIN_PATH varchar(191)
SHOW_COUNTERS enum('N','Y')
AUDITION_PREROLL int(11)
TITLE_TEMPLATE varchar(64)
ARTIST_TEMPLATE varchar(64)
OUTCUE_TEMPLATE varchar(64)
DESCRIPTION_TEMPLATE varchar(64)